Competed in pole vaulting and represented Germany in international events. Participated in the 1960 Rome Olympics, showcasing athletic skill on a global platform. Lehnertz achieved national success, securing titles in German championships during the late 1950s and early 1960s. Contributed to the development of pole vaulting techniques within Germany.

Competed in the 1960 Rome Olympics

Won titles at German national championships
